EDMONTON, AB - Defenceman Matt Benning was sporting a full cage at Oilers practice on Wednesday after taking a puck up high in yesterday's 8-4 victory against the Los Angeles Kings.
"A few chipped teeth, a few stitches, and a swollen mouth," Benning said to the media this afternoon from the Oilers dressing room, with a fresh cut stitched above his swollen upper lip. "It wasn't as bad as people thought, it could've been a lot worse, but my lip took most of the blow.
"Probably looks worse than it feels, but my chipped tooth is a little sensitive. That's the worst part, but I go to the dentist this afternoon and then we'll go from there."
